Hi Kellie,

Although I can't recommend a specific dr. in Dallas, you will probably want to start with a reproductive endo, rather than a regular endo. Even if you're not trying to conceive, a reproductive endo should have (hopefully!) a better handle on treating pcos:) !

I would also suggest looking on www.soulcysters.com. The site has a state by state listing (and reviews) of drs. who specialize in treating pcos.
